The 2022 FIFA world cup was held in Qatar from 20th November to 18th December. So far, this tournament was the most thrilling in the history of football. There have been surprises and stellar performances from many underdog nations like Africa and Asia. There have been 32 teams participating in the game. It was the first time the World Cup was held in the Arab and Muslim world and the second time in Asia after the 2002 World Cup. The game was not only thrilling because of unexpected results, but also for its cost. It was the most expensive world cup to hold till today. The estimated cost of this world cup is around 220 Billion. Everything was assembled so accurately that the stadiums were describing zero waste. The upper tiers of the stadium were disassembled because it was donated to countries with less developed sports infrastructure. In Bangladesh, the supporters give tribute to their favorite teams by hoisting flags, painting on the walls of the road, wearing their favorite jerseys and watching the matches on big screens.
